How Melandi’s Approaches Work Online

Melandi uses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to help people identify unhelpful thoughts and try new behaviors. CBT is helpful for anxiety, mood problems, and sleep disruption by turning insight into practical change.

She also incorporates Mindfulness Therapy to teach attention and grounding techniques. Mindfulness helps reduce stress and manage emotional intensity in small, usable steps.

Finding the right approach is a collaborative process. She will work with each person to choose which methods fit their goals and preferences and adjust plans as progress is made.

Online formats offer practical flexibility. Video calls let you have a fuller conversation and see visual cues. Phone sessions can fit a busy schedule or use less bandwidth. Live chat and text messaging are useful for quick check-ins, brief skill practice, or when writing feels easier than talking.

These options make it simpler to keep therapy consistent during workweeks, caregiving days, or while traveling. The focus is on accessible ways to learn skills and track progress with a licensed professional.
